Subject: Quickstore 4.2 — bloom filter now fronts the KV layer

Plugin authors: starting with this release, Quickstore places a bloom filter ahead of the key-value store. Negative lookups return faster; false positives fall through safely. No API changes are required on your side. Verify your plugin against the staging build referenced below.

session token of fahif-tadup = htk3_9c7

Briefing — Leadership Review: Dunmere Lease Renegotiation

Quick primer for you ahead of Thursday. Our lease on the Dunmere campus expires in fourteen months, and the landlord, Strathby Estates, has opened with a 22% uplift. We think there's room: vacancy in the district is high, and we're their anchor tenant. Options on the table are a shorter renewal with a break clause, consolidating into two floors, or relocating to the Felbourne site. Jorun has run the numbers. Our preferred position is set out in the confidential note below.

internal memo for kawip-hadug: Headcount on the Wenwyn team goes from 7 to 140 by the end of January. Gross margin on Wenwyn came in at 20 percent against a plan of 15 percent.

**Postmortem timeline — Pairwise matching service GC pauses**

14:02 — Matchgrove's pairwise service began logging stop-the-world GC pauses exceeding 1.8s, triggering downstream timeouts in the Orvane queue. 14:11 — Heap dumps showed candidate-set caching retaining expired match windows. 14:26 — Rolled the cache TTL patch to one canary node; pauses dropped under 120ms. For the release manager: the canary carried the build identified by the token recorded immediately below.

trace token, fahaf-bagep: htk21_c824960d2569acf0442af